Board Members                                                                         
Timor Aid has been registered with the United Nations Transitional Administration (UNTAET), the governing authority in East Timor. Its Constitution, valid from 01 January 2000, specifies 5 Founding Members of the organization who must be East Timorese or people that were eligible to vote in the August 1999 UN sponsored Consultation. The 5 founding members plus 5 people form the governing body of the organization, to be Chaired by Honorary Chairman Dr José Ramos Horta.
